As we move through Friday, we'll see clouds begin to build throughout the day. The good news is that most of us will remain dry through Saturday afternoon, thanks to a high-pressure system lingering in the area. We expect highs in the mid-60s for Friday and low 60s for Saturday, with lighter winds. However, we are keeping a close eye on an approaching system that will gradually bring changes.

Starting Saturday night, rain chances begin to increase significantly, and we're forecasting periods of rain from Saturday night right through Sunday. Sunday looks like our wettest day for the upcoming forecast period, with a 90% chance of rain and potentially around a half an inch of accumulation.
